#91259d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#91259d is composed of 56.9% red, 14.5%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.6% cyan, 76.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 294 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 38%. #91259d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#23003b.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#91259d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#91259d has RGB values of R:145, G:37,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 9512349.

Shades and Tints of #91259d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#91259d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616161 is the less saturated color, while #a907bb is the most saturated one.
